Como conhecer a versão instalada de pesquisa elástica do kibana?
actualmente estou a receber estes alertas:
Alguém pode dizer-me se há uma forma de encontrar a versão exacta do ELS?A actualização necessária para a sua versão da Elasticsearch é demasiado antiga. O Kibana requer uma pesquisa elastica de 0,90,9 ou mais.
7 answers
Do cliente Chrome Rest faça um pedido ou
curl -XGET 'http://localhost:9200'
na consola
Cliente de manutenção: http://localhost:9200
{
"name": "node",
"cluster_name": "elasticsearch-cluster",
"version": {
"number": "2.3.4",
"build_hash": "dcxbgvzdfbbhfxbhx",
"build_timestamp": "2016-06-30T11:24:31Z",
"build_snapshot": false,
"lucene_version": "5.5.0"
},
"tagline": "You Know, for Search"
}
Onde o campo Número denota a versão elasticsearch
. Aqui elasticsearch
a versão é 2.3.4
Da consola dev do seu kibana, carregue no seguinte comando:
GET /
Isto é semelhante ao acesso localhost:9200
a partir do navegador.
Pode verificar a versão da pesquisa elastica pelo seguinte comando. Também devolve algumas outras informações:
Curl-XGET 'localhost:9200'
{
"name" : "Forgotten One",
"cluster_name" : "elasticsearch",
"version" : {
"number" : "2.3.4",
"build_hash" : "e455fd0c13dceca8dbbdbb1665d068ae55dabe3f",
"build_timestamp" : "2016-06-30T11:24:31Z",
"build_snapshot" : false,
"lucene_version" : "5.5.0"
},
"tagline" : "You Know, for Search"
}
Aqui você pode ver o número da versão: 2.3.4
Tipicamente o Kibana está instalado em /opt/logstash/bin / kibana . Então você pode obter a versão kibana do seguinte modo
/opt/kibana/bin/kibana --version
Para verificar a versão do seu Kibana em execução, tente isto:
Passo 1. Comece o seu serviço de Kibana.
Passo 2. Abrir o navegador e o tipo abaixo da Linha,
localhost:5601
Passo 3. Ir para a configuração- > acerca de
You can See Version of Your Running kibana.
Navegar para a pasta onde instalou o seu kibana se usou o yum para instalar o kibana será colocado no seguinte local por omissão
/usr/share/kibana
Então use o seguinte comando
bin/kibana --version
localhost:9200
It will give Output Something like that,
{
"status" : 200,
"name" : "Hypnotia",
"cluster_name" : "elasticsearch",
"version" : {
"number" : "1.7.1",
"build_hash" : "b88f43fc40b0bcd7f173a1f9ee2e97816de80b19",
"build_timestamp" : "2015-07-29T09:54:16Z",
"build_snapshot" : false,
"lucene_version" : "4.10.4"
},
"tagline" : "You Know, for Search"
}
Se instalou o X-pack para proteger o elasticseach, o pedido deve conter os detalhes credenciais válidos.
curl -XGET -u "elastic:passwordForElasticUser" 'localhost:9200'
Na verdade, se a segurança ativou todos os pedidos subsequentes devem seguir o mesmo padrão (as credenciais inline devem ser fornecidas).